Port Overview
Pulau Nai, Indonesia, has no docking; ships anchor offshore with tenders to sandy beaches. Travelers snorkel coral reefs and explore traditional villages. Excursions include diving in Banda Sea. No facilities exist; provisions are ship-based. The peak season, May to October, brings dry weather for marine activities. Photography captures turquoise waters and spice plantations. Dining onboard includes ikan bakar, an Indonesian favorite. Souvenirs, like nutmeg crafts, are sold in ship shops. Briefings cover Maluku history. Light clothing and sun protection suit the tropical climate, while snorkeling gear enhances reef exploration. Pulau Nai’s tropical allure offers a vibrant Indonesian stop. Cruise travelers enjoy a mix of marine adventures and cultural heritage, making Pulau Nai an engaging destination for Indonesia’s remote islands.
